Renamed setting: UPLINK_MODE is now TELEMETRY_UPLINK_MODE across the FieldHarvest telemetry gateway. Old configs keep working until v5.0 but log a deprecation warning on boot, so expect tickets about that message from farm operators. Support should tell customers to update their .env files and restart the gateway service. No behavioral change otherwise — batching intervals and retry logic are untouched. After renaming the setting, customers must also re-add the uplink credential on the line directly after it.

sealed setting: ARCHIVE_KEY3=8d0

Step 3 — Deploying the Reportelle sort-stability patch

After confirming the stable-sort flag is enabled in the build config, sign the release artifact before promotion. The reviewer should verify that the comparator change preserves row order for equal keys, then approve the signed bundle. The pipeline expects the artifact signed with the key below.

release key, hadug-kawef: bky13_mPGeFZeR1GZ1G

Handover: Drossel calendar sync conflict. The Plumwick connector double-books when an event is edited on both ends within the debounce window. Root cause is last-write-wins on the upstream Hollowvale API; our merge layer masks it badly. Plugin authors: do not write directly to the sync table — use the conflict queue. I've raised the debounce to 30s in staging; prod unchanged. Repro steps are in the tracker. The sync worker picks up its settings from the block that follows.

deployment values, baweg-yadup:
[kasion]
team = druax
access_code = ac_4cb240
owner = istox.quenix
host = kasion.qorvelnet.internal
port = 3306
peer = ralion.olvarqsoft.local
salt = cf4e7133
pin = 6291

### Webhook retries — the quick version

Welcome to the Bramblehook support rotation! Our webhook sender retries failed deliveries five times with exponential backoff, capped at six hours. After that, events land in the dead-letter queue, which you can replay from the console. To unlock the replay console the first time, you'll need the recovery passphrase listed below.

vault phrase of tajeg-tageg = pelix-druix-holius-briael-zorwyn-frawyn-fraox-norok-drueth-aldiel